Community cloud vendors are normally hunting for methods to lengthen their attain, and a person of the methods they have state-of-the-art those people attempts is with superior-effectiveness computing.
AWS, Microsoft and Google are owning success with high-efficiency computing (HPC) companies due to the fact of the comfort they offer for enterprises. Which is since HPC requires sizable investments in information middle tools, enterprise processes and routine maintenance. Couple of enterprises have the in-residence processing electricity or personnel talent sets demanded to meet up with those people calls for.
Public cloud lowers barrier to adoption in HPC current market
HPC purposes chew up tons of assets — normally requiring specifically developed servers — to operate complex mathematic calculations, this sort of as computational fluid dynamics and economical analysis simulations, in accordance to Charles King, an analyst at Pund-IT Inc.
Also, traditionally, HPC programs had been developed in proprietary progress environments, with generally obscure programming resources. Now, the public cloud provides corporations with the wanted adaptability, as very well as application progress environments that are open supply, standardized and broadly adopted.
“Cloud computing has expanded the HPC marketplace and has even more democratized it by making HPC available to new adopters that deficiency on-premises HPC methods,” mentioned Steve Conway, senior exploration vice president at Hyperion Exploration in St. Paul, Minn.
Enterprises can now operate additional demanding HPC purposes on the community cloud for use scenarios this kind of as details evaluation, automatic driving programs, precision medication, affinity marketing, organization intelligence, cybersecurity, intelligent towns and the internet of things course, Conway mentioned.
Enterprises that already have HPC infrastructure on premises will find it impractical to migrate their entire HPC infrastructure to the cloud, but they can transfer elements of it.
“Software growth can take position in the general public cloud, and enterprises can operate the code in their info centers,” claimed Karl Freund, consulting lead for HPC and deep learning at Moor Insights & System.
A lot of HPC purposes have sporadic computing demands. For instance, an oil company may possibly need to have to determine the best location to drill, but it only requirements to operate that evaluation once each six months. With cloud, organizations accessibility the important computing providers as desired.
Cloud distributors hurry to fill gaps with HPC expert services
AWS, Microsoft and Google have moved aggressively to address the desire for HPC services. They also see it as a way to increase the return on their information center investments, simply because it can set idling computing power to do the job, Freund stated.
In October 2017, Microsoft signed an arrangement with Cray, a longtime chief in the HPC industry, to carry its products and services to Azure. The very same yr, it acquired Cycle Computing, which centered on HPC. In May possibly 2019, Microsoft explained its Azure Digital Equipment HB-series scaled to 10,000 cores, a cloud high-h2o mark.
AWS’ HPC choices present a range of compute occasion kinds that can be configured by just about every customer. They characteristic Intel Xeon processor-run CPU circumstances, GPU-primarily based instances and circumstances driven by area-programmable gate arrays.
In April 2019, Google expanded its Google Compute Motor VM offerings to include things like Compute- and Memory-Optimized VMs a Google Cloud Platform Marketplace services for Lustre from DataDirect Networks and guidance for working T4 GPUs on GCP.
Do the job stays
Despite the initiatives of cloud companies to broaden their HPC expert services, enterprises nevertheless facial area obstacles to adoption. These applications have to have terabytes of facts, so it can be not possible to deliver the facts by way of a substantial-velocity WAN link. Rather, cloud vendors supply offline migration companies, these as AWS Snowball, where by they bodily pack up the data and provide it from the customer’s info centre to their personal services.
Even so, there are a many probable problems that could hinder this solution for the time currently being. For starters, packing up petabytes of details is exceptionally difficult, and end users generally invest sizeable time staging info and tuning algorithms. It can get months to reconstruct the info to run jobs in a new setting publish-migration. In limited, the opportunity for complications is larger than normal, and the tolerance for hazard is a lot reduced — not the most effective mixture.
The broader issue is the simple fact that HPC is at odds with the generic mother nature of the community cloud. These sellers are improved at generic, commodity solutions, so HPC is a little bit outside the house their comfort and ease zone.
“Most HPC techniques are made to guidance particular styles of tasks and workloads,” King explained. “Dealing with tasks from a broad selection of corporations and HPC programs is pretty unconventional. Distributors could discover that they’re crafting the rule book as they go together.”
Continue to, when HPC expert services are generating sluggish development in the organization industry, they could achieve an inflection issue. To date, public cloud supports less than 10% of HPC jobs, and that variety is predicted to attain about…